Removing ear wax with hydrogen peroxide is a common home remedy, but it’s essential to approach it with caution and precision. The process involves using a diluted solution of hydrogen peroxide, typically 3%, and applying a few drops into the ear canal to help soften and dislodge the wax. However, the exact number of drops can vary depending on factors such as the severity of the wax buildup and individual ear anatomy. Generally, 2 to 3 drops are recommended, followed by a few minutes of allowing the solution to work before draining it out. It’s crucial to consult a healthcare professional before attempting this method, especially if you have a history of ear infections, perforated eardrums, or other ear-related issues, to ensure safety and effectiveness.

Safe dosage guidelines for hydrogen peroxide in ear wax removal

Hydrogen peroxide is a popular home remedy for ear wax removal, but its use requires precision to avoid harm. The safe dosage for adults typically ranges from 2 to 4 drops of a 3% hydrogen peroxide solution per ear. This concentration is crucial; higher strengths can irritate or damage the delicate skin of the ear canal. For children, consult a healthcare professional before use, as their ear canals are smaller and more sensitive. Always tilt the head to the side when administering drops, holding the position for 3–5 minutes to allow the solution to work effectively.

The mechanism behind hydrogen peroxide’s effectiveness lies in its effervescent action, which softens and breaks down ear wax. However, overuse can lead to adverse effects. Applying more than the recommended 4 drops or using the solution daily can cause dryness, itching, or even chemical burns. A safe practice is to limit treatment to once every 2–3 days, monitoring for any signs of discomfort. If irritation occurs, discontinue use immediately and rinse the ear with sterile water.

Comparing hydrogen peroxide to other ear wax removal methods highlights its accessibility but underscores the need for caution. Unlike ear irrigation or manual removal by a professional, hydrogen peroxide is a self-administered solution, making dosage control critical. For instance, over-the-counter ear drops often contain oils or glycerin, which are gentler but less immediate in action. Hydrogen peroxide’s strength is its rapid effect, but this comes with a higher risk if misused.

Practical tips can enhance safety and efficacy. Warm the hydrogen peroxide solution to body temperature before use to prevent dizziness or discomfort. After application, allow the liquid to drain naturally by tilting the head in the opposite direction. Avoid using cotton swabs to remove wax afterward, as this can push debris deeper into the ear. For stubborn blockages, combine hydrogen peroxide with a few drops of olive oil to enhance softening, but never exceed the recommended dosage of either substance.

In conclusion, while hydrogen peroxide is a viable option for ear wax removal, adherence to safe dosage guidelines is non-negotiable. Adults should use 2–4 drops of a 3% solution, applied sparingly and with caution. Children and individuals with sensitive ears should seek professional advice. By following these instructions and monitoring for adverse reactions, users can safely leverage hydrogen peroxide’s benefits without compromising ear health.

Potential risks and side effects of using hydrogen peroxide in ears

Using hydrogen peroxide to remove ear wax can lead to unintended consequences if not approached with caution. One of the primary risks is chemical irritation, especially when the solution is not properly diluted. Undiluted 3% hydrogen peroxide, commonly found in households, can cause redness, itching, or a burning sensation in the ear canal. For children or individuals with sensitive skin, even diluted solutions may provoke discomfort. Always mix hydrogen peroxide with an equal amount of distilled water (1:1 ratio) to minimize this risk, and never exceed 3–4 drops per ear.

Another significant concern is tympanic membrane damage, particularly if the peroxide is applied incorrectly. The force of dropping the liquid or inserting a cotton swab afterward can push the solution against the eardrum, potentially causing pain or rupture. This risk is heightened in individuals with pre-existing ear conditions, such as a perforated eardrum or ongoing infection. To mitigate this, tilt the head to the side and gently pull the earlobe back and up (for adults) or down and back (for children) to straighten the ear canal before administering drops.

Infection is a lesser-known but serious side effect of using hydrogen peroxide in the ears. While the solution is antibacterial, its use can disrupt the ear’s natural pH balance, creating an environment conducive to bacterial or fungal growth. This is especially true if the peroxide is not allowed to fully drain or if water remains trapped in the ear after treatment. Always dry the outer ear thoroughly with a towel and tilt the head to let the solution drain completely. Avoid using hydrogen peroxide if the ear is already infected or if there is discharge present.

Lastly, overuse of hydrogen peroxide can lead to dryness and skin breakdown in the ear canal. Repeated applications, particularly within a short timeframe, strip the ear’s natural oils, causing flaking, cracking, or even bleeding. Limit treatments to once every 48 hours and no more than three consecutive days. If ear wax persists, consult a healthcare professional instead of continuing home remedies, as excessive wax may require irrigation or manual removal by a specialist.

In summary, while hydrogen peroxide can be effective for ear wax removal, its risks—chemical irritation, eardrum damage, infection, and skin dryness—demand careful application. Dilute the solution, use proper technique, and adhere to dosage guidelines to minimize side effects. When in doubt, prioritize professional advice over home treatments.

Step-by-step instructions for applying hydrogen peroxide to remove ear wax

Step 1: Preparation and Dosage

Begin by ensuring you have the right concentration of hydrogen peroxide—3% is the standard, safe option for at-home use. For adults, tilt your head and gently place 3 to 4 drops into the affected ear canal using a clean dropper. Children over 12 may use 2 to 3 drops, but always consult a pediatrician first. Keep the solution at room temperature to avoid discomfort. Have a towel ready, as the process can be slightly messy.

Step 2: Application Technique

With your head tilted, allow the hydrogen peroxide to sit in the ear for 5 to 10 minutes. You may hear fizzing or bubbling, which indicates the peroxide is breaking down the wax. This effervescent action helps soften and dislodge the buildup. Keep still during this time to prevent leakage. If you experience stinging or irritation, remove the solution immediately and rinse with sterile water.

Step 3: Drainage and Cleaning

After the waiting period, tilt your head over a sink or bowl to let the solution and loosened wax drain out. Follow this by gently rinsing the ear with warm water using a bulb syringe. Avoid forceful irrigation, as it can damage the eardrum. For stubborn wax, repeat the process once daily for up to 3 days, but discontinue if irritation persists.

Step 4: Post-Treatment Care

Once the ear is drained, dry the outer ear gently with a towel or a hairdryer on low heat. Avoid inserting cotton swabs or any objects into the ear canal, as this can push wax deeper or cause injury. If symptoms like pain, discharge, or hearing loss continue, seek medical attention. Proper aftercare ensures the ear remains healthy and free from infection.

Cautions and Considerations

Hydrogen peroxide is not suitable for everyone. Avoid use if you have a perforated eardrum, ear infection, or tubes in your ears. Pregnant women and individuals with sensitive skin should consult a healthcare provider before proceeding. Overuse can lead to skin irritation or dryness, so adhere strictly to the recommended dosage and frequency. Always prioritize safety and consult a professional if unsure.

Alternatives to hydrogen peroxide for effective ear wax removal

While hydrogen peroxide is a common go-to for ear wax removal, it’s not the only option—and it’s not always the best one. For those seeking alternatives, mineral oil offers a gentle, effective solution. To use, warm a small amount of mineral oil to body temperature (not hot) and apply 2–3 drops into the ear canal using a clean dropper. Let it sit for 5–10 minutes, then tilt your head to drain. This method softens wax without the potential irritation hydrogen peroxide can cause, making it suitable for adults and children over 2 years old. Always avoid if there’s a suspected ear infection or perforated eardrum.

Another reliable alternative is saline solution, which mimics the body’s natural fluids and is particularly safe for sensitive ears. Mix 1 teaspoon of salt in ½ cup of warm water until fully dissolved, then use a bulb syringe to gently squirt the solution into the ear. Tilt your head to allow it to flow out, taking wax with it. This method is ideal for mild to moderate wax buildup and can be repeated daily for up to 5 days. However, avoid forceful irrigation, as it may push wax deeper or cause injury.

For those preferring over-the-counter options, carbamide peroxide-based ear drops (like Debrox) are a hydrogen peroxide alternative with a lower risk of irritation. Administer 5–10 drops into the ear, leave for 5–10 minutes, and flush with warm water. These drops are safe for adults and children over 12, but always follow the product’s instructions. Unlike hydrogen peroxide, carbamide peroxide releases oxygen slowly, reducing the chance of discomfort.

A more natural approach involves olive oil or baby oil, which lubricate and soften wax over time. Warm 2–3 drops of oil (not hot) and apply to the ear canal before bed for 3–5 nights. The wax will gradually loosen and may fall out on its own or be gently removed with a damp cloth. This method is especially mild, making it suitable for all ages, but results take longer compared to other alternatives.

Lastly, consider ear irrigation kits, which use a controlled flow of warm water to flush out wax. These kits are available at pharmacies and include a basin and syringe for safe, at-home use. Fill the basin with warm water (around 100°F) and position it at ear level, then gently irrigate the ear. This method is highly effective for moderate to severe buildup but should be avoided if you have diabetes, ear tubes, or a history of ear surgery. Always consult a healthcare provider if unsure.

Each alternative has its strengths, and the best choice depends on the severity of the buildup, sensitivity, and personal preference. When in doubt, consult a healthcare professional to ensure safe and effective ear wax removal.

How to determine if hydrogen peroxide is suitable for your ear wax issue

Before reaching for hydrogen peroxide, assess the nature of your ear wax issue. Ear wax, or cerumen, is a natural protector of the ear canal, trapping dust and debris. However, excessive buildup can lead to discomfort or hearing impairment. Hydrogen peroxide is often recommended for its effervescent action, which softens and helps dislodge impacted wax. But not all ear wax issues are created equal, and suitability depends on factors like the type of wax, the severity of the blockage, and your medical history.

Step-by-Step Evaluation:

  • Identify the Type of Ear Wax: Wet ear wax, common in Caucasians and Africans, is typically easier to manage with hydrogen peroxide due to its softer consistency. Dry ear wax, more prevalent in East Asians, may require additional softening agents.
  • Assess Severity: Mild cases with no symptoms may not need intervention. Moderate cases with itching or muffled hearing could benefit from hydrogen peroxide. Severe blockages, especially with pain or discharge, require professional evaluation.
  • Check Medical History: Avoid hydrogen peroxide if you have a perforated eardrum, ear infection, or eczema in the ear canal, as it can exacerbate these conditions. Consult a healthcare provider if unsure.

Dosage and Application Tips: For suitable candidates, use 3–4 drops of 3% hydrogen peroxide in the affected ear. Tilt your head, let it sit for 5–10 minutes, then drain. Repeat once daily for 3–5 days. Warm the solution to body temperature to prevent dizziness.

Comparative Analysis: Hydrogen peroxide is a cost-effective, accessible option compared to over-the-counter drops or professional irrigation. However, it’s less effective for dry, hardened wax, where oil-based softeners like baby oil or glycerin may be superior.

Practical Takeaway: Hydrogen peroxide is a viable solution for mild to moderate wet ear wax buildup in individuals without underlying ear conditions. Always prioritize safety by verifying suitability and following proper dosage guidelines. When in doubt, consult an audiologist or ENT specialist to avoid complications.
